Here they are again: Then thinking about Merry's life: He was raised the scion of a wealthy family, but outside the four farthings. He's half-Took. Leaving the Shire with Frodo - for friendship or adventure? How does Merry handle himself as the adventure becomes something much larger and much more dangerous? What does he offer to/gain from the other three Hobbits? We can especially look at the Merry/Pippin relationship. Merry 'mentors' Pippin a lot, but what does Pippen do for Merry? What does he learn from or offer to the other five members of the Fellowship? Why does Merry attach himself to Theoden? And then Eowyn? Merry was terrified at Weathertop, but managed to stab the Witch King at Pellenor, and then leads the Battle of Bywater. Merry is intelligent and a good planner, he shows compassion, and is capable of violence at need.
